"""
This module includes:
- HIGIpEntry a simple IP widget
"""
import re
import gtk
import gobject
class HIGIpEntry(gtk.HBox):
"""
A simple IP widget Entry
"""
__gtype_name__ = "HIGIpEntry"
__gsignals__ = {
'changed' : (gobject.SIGNAL_RUN_LAST, gobject.TYPE_NONE, ())
}
regex = re.compile("\\b(25[0-5]|2[0-4][0-9]|[01]?[0-9][0-9]?)\\.(25[0-5]|2[0-4][0-9]|[01]?[0-9][0-9]?)\\.(25[0-5]|2[0-4][0-9]|[01]?[0-9][0-9]?)\\.(25[0-5]|2[0-4][0-9]|[01]?[0-9][0-9]?)\\b")
def __init__(self):
gtk.HBox.__init__(self, False, 2)
self._current = None
self._entries = [gtk.Entry(3) for i in xrange(4)]
self._img_error = gtk.image_new_from_stock(
gtk.STOCK_DIALOG_ERROR, gtk.ICON_SIZE_MENU
)
self._img_ok = gtk.image_new_from_stock(
gtk.STOCK_APPLY, gtk.ICON_SIZE_MENU
)
self.has_frame = True
redraw = lambda x, y, root: root.queue_draw()
for entry in self._entries:
entry.connect('focus-in-event', redraw, self)
entry.connect('focus-out-event', redraw, self)
entry.connect('key-press-event', self.__on_key_press)
entry.connect('key-release-event', self.__on_key_release)
self.__pack_widgets()
def __pack_widgets(self):
self.set_border_width(4)
for e in self._entries:
e.set_alignment(0.5)
e.set_has_frame(False)
e.set_width_chars(3)
self.pack_start(self._entries[0], False, False, 0)
self.pack_start(gtk.Label("."), False, False, 0)
self.pack_start(self._entries[1], False, False, 0)
self.pack_start(gtk.Label("."), False, False, 0)
self.pack_start(self._entries[2], False, False, 0)
self.pack_start(gtk.Label("."), False, False, 0)
self.pack_start(self._entries[3], False, False, 0)
self.pack_start(self._img_error, False, False, 0)
self.pack_start(self._img_ok, False, False, 0)
self.show_all()
def do_realize(self):
gtk.HBox.do_realize(self)
self._img_ok.hide()
def __on_key_press(self, widget, evt):
if evt.keyval == gtk.keysyms.BackSpace:
self.__move_next(False)
return True
elif evt.keyval <= 256 and chr(evt.keyval) == '.':
self.__move_next()
return True
return False
def __on_key_release(self, widget, evt):
if evt.keyval <= 256 and chr(evt.keyval).isdigit() and \
widget.get_property('cursor_position') == 3:
self.__move_next()
self.__validate()
return False
def __move_next(self, up=True):
if not self._current:
if up:
i = -1
else:
i = len(self._entries)
else:
i = self._entries.index(self._current)
if up:
i += 1
else:
i -= 1
if i < 0 or i >= 4:
i = 0
self._entries[i].grab_focus()
self._current = self._entries[i]
def __validate(self):
if HIGIpEntry.regex.match(self.text):
self._img_error.hide()
self._img_ok.show()
self.emit('changed')
else:
self._img_error.show()
self._img_ok.hide()
def do_expose_event(self, evt):
alloc = self.allocation
rect = gtk.gdk.Rectangle(alloc.x, alloc.y, alloc.width, alloc.height)
if not self._current:
self._current = self._entries[0]
if self.has_frame:
self.style.paint_flat_box(
self.window,
self._current.state,
self._current.get_property('shadow_type'),
alloc,
self._current,
'entry_bg',
rect.x, rect.y, rect.width, rect.height
)
self.style.paint_shadow(
self.window,
self._current.state,
self._current.get_property('shadow_type'),
alloc,
self._current,
'entry',
rect.x, rect.y, rect.width, rect.height
)
return gtk.Bin.do_expose_event(self, evt)
def get_text(self):
return ".".join(map(lambda e: e.get_text(), self._entries))
def set_text(self, txt):
t = txt.split(".")
if len(t) == 4:
[e.set_text(v) for e, v in zip(self._entries, t)]
def set_has_frame(self, val):
self.has_frame = val
def get_has_frame(self):
return self.has_frame
text = property(get_text, set_text)
gobject.type_register(HIGIpEntry)
if __name__ == "__main__":
w = gtk.Window()
bb = gtk.VBox()
bb.pack_start(gtk.Label("This is a dummy ip widget:"), False, False)
bb.pack_start(HIGIpEntry())
w.add(bb)
w.show_all()
w.connect('delete-event', lambda *w: gtk.main_quit())
gtk.main()
